INFORMATION

This equipment generates and uses radio frequency
energy and if not installed and used properly, that is, in
strict acc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ions, may
cause interference to radio and television reception. It has
been type tested and found to comply with the limits for a
Class B computing device in accordance with the
specifications in Subpart J of Part 15 of FCC Rules, which
are designed to provide reasonable protection against
such interference in a residential installation. However,
there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a

particular installation. If this equipment does cause
interference to radio or television reception, which can be
determ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user
is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or
more of the following measures:

Reorient the receiving antenna
Relocate the equipment with respect to the receiver
Move the equipment away from the receiver
Plug the equipment into a different outlet so that
equipment and receiver are on different branch circuits.

If necessary, the user should consult the dealer or an
experienced radio/television technician for additional
suggestions. The user may find the following booklet
prepared by the Federal Communications Commission
helpful:
“How to identify and Resolve Radio-TV interference

Problems”.
This booklet is available from the U.S. Government

Printing Office, Washington, DC 20402, Stock No. 004-
000-00345-4.

Differences by Model

This instruction manual covers the CDP-C77ES and the
CDP-C87ES. Their performance and operation is identical
except for the following:
CDP-C87ES comes with a SERIAL CHAIN terminal and

CONTROL SIN/OUT terminals.

Note on the Transit Key

The transit key and the red lock screw (CDP-C87ES only)
on the bottom exterior of the unit protects the optical
system against shock during transportation. Before
operating the CD player, be sure to remove the key and
red lock screw (CDP-C87ES only) by following the
instructions on the label, and store it in a safe place.

When transporting the unit, replace the key and red lock
screw (CDP-C87ES only) in its original hole and lock it in
place.

Re-install the red lock screw

1. Open the disc compertment by pressing the —

OPEN/CLOSE button.

2. Press the DISC SKIP button until disc tray 1 is at the

front.

3. Close the disc compertment by pressing the —

OPEN/CLOSE button.

4.

Wait for the 0 (DISC 1) indicator to blink before turning

the power off. Re-install the transporting lock screw.
